New Kits this Matchweek
There was just the one new kit on show this weekend.
AFC Bournemouth wore their first Kit Variation of the season, with their away kit being used with alternative navy socks to their visit to Newcastle United, this becomes the 98th Kit used in the Premier League this season!

Kit Highlights
Wolverhampton Wanderers have now used their Away Kit four times this season, racking up 10 point with three victories and draw, the fourth team to reach double figures for points but have the joint highest “Points per game” in the Kit with Liverpool.

Aston Villa were the only team this matchweek to wear their Home Kit away from home, it also is the first time that they have worn their Default Home Kit (Home Shirt / White shorts & Sky Blue Socks) away from Villa Park this season in the Premier League.

My favourite Kit Match Up of this weekend was at the game between Brentford and Liverpool, one of the best Brentford Home Kits in their Umbro period, and an interesting Liverpool 3rd Kit, the Purple an unusual colour in football but one that has strong links with the city of Liverpool, this Kit does work well for me and matched up with this Brentford kit gave us a good kit match up.

Kit Stats
Overall we have seen 11 Home Kits, 7 Away Kits and 2 3rd Kits in action in this Matchweek
There was there five Kit Variations on show this week.
- AFC Bournemouth in Away Kit with Navy Socks
- West Ham United in Away Kit with alternative sky blue shorts, 3rd time this look has been used
- Brighton & Hove Albion in Away Kit with white shorts and socks, the 2nd time used
- Manchester United in 3rd Kit with alternative white socks, the 5th time they have been used
- Crystal Palace in Away / Home Kit Mash up, with Away kit paired with Home socks, the 2nd time seen in the League
